    I don't like hack-a-Shaq, but since it's well within the rules, if you're going to do it, do it. Don't wait until the fourth quarter. If it's an advantage, use it as much as you can to take advantage of that advantage. That's the genius of Gregg Popovich. Sure, he was micro-managing the game. And, yes it was somewhat painful to watch. And, to a point, it was even embarrassing. But, he knew what the Suns were capable of on offense. That shows respect for the Suns offense, respect towards Shaq as an impact player, and wise strategy to ensure a win even when the Suns make a run later in the game. I really don't like hack-a-Shaq. But, if you're going to use it, take full advantage. Pop shows once again why he's one of the best coaches in the game. There was no shame on his part. He stayed with the gameplan even when Shaq made free throws. And, each time he used it, it helped put his team in better position to win.
